Transaction 62ec525f6221ab353faf4a1401d435673140abb3e8c897ecb541dd1026f07ce0

2 Input
2 Outputs
  • 62ec525f6221ab353faf4a1401d435673140abb3e8c897ecb541dd1026f07ce0:0
  • value  367942
    address  1nr5PErsZNFe6tbKGhTF8TKgxgp6WVqyb
  • 62ec525f6221ab353faf4a1401d435673140abb3e8c897ecb541dd1026f07ce0:1
  • value  520000
    address  1uk3ZYRvDXknrUCaWRXux9hLkZyggKy6p